The Setup Developer Module builds you a complete baseline setup from a blank sheet. Use it when you’re new to a car, new to a track, or just want a setup that makes sense before you start fine-tuning. It works subject by subject — ride height, then springs, then anti-roll bars, and so on — so you’re never staring at twelve setup screens trying to guess where to start.

Starting a session – selections
Launch Setup Developer from the Launcher.
First screen: tell it what you’re driving. Don’t overthink these choices — onRails uses them to set a sensible baseline and skip subjects that don’t apply, not to grade you. If you’re not sure which one fits, take your best guess; it has no negative effect on the recommendations you’ll get.
Pick whichever of these is the closest match to what you’re driving:
- Hi-tech Open Wheel — top-tier open-wheel (e.g. F1-style).
- Mid-tech Open Wheel — mid-tier open-wheel (e.g. F2/F3/Indy-style).
- Low-tech Open Wheel — entry-level open-wheel/formula cars, little to no aero.
- Prototype Sportscar — closed-cockpit endurance prototypes (LMP-style).
- Grand Touring Sportscar — GT-style sportscars.
- Touring Car — production-based touring cars.
- Open Wheel Oval — open-wheel cars built for oval racing.
- Stock Car Oval — stock cars built for oval racing.
This changes which setup subjects apply — a Low-tech Open Wheel car with no aero skips the aero questions, for instance.
Pick whichever is closest to the track you’re actually running. This nudges the baseline setup in the right direction — a low-speed road course leans on more front aero and softer springs than a superspeedway, for example.
- High speed roadcourse
- Mixed speed roadcourse
- Low speed roadcourse
- Superspeedway (oval)
- Speedway (oval)
- Short oval
Pick a mismatched car/track combo (an Open Wheel Oval car on a road course, say) and SD warns you but doesn’t block you — most of these combos are rare but not impossible.
Track variables
After track type, you’ll see four optional toggles that fine-tune the baseline further:
- Chicanes — quick left-right-left sections.
- Bumpy — rough or uneven track surface.
- Banked — corners with meaningful banking.
- Long Corners — sustained, high-load corners rather than quick transitions.
These are variables, not requirements — leave any of them off if you’re unsure or if they don’t apply. Toggling one on nudges specific values (springs, dampers, ARBs, etc.) in the direction that variable usually calls for; it’s a refinement on top of your track type pick, not a separate decision to agonize over.

Working through the subjects
onRails’ Setup Developer walks you through 12 groups of subjects in this order:
Ride Height → Springs → Anti-Roll Bars → Weight → Cross Weight/Wedge → Trackbar → Tires & Camber → Toe → Gearing → Differential → Dampers → Aerodynamics
(Groups that don’t apply to your car/track combo — trackbar and wedge on a road course, for instance — are skipped automatically.)
Each subject works the same way:
- Read the question.
- Answer using the dropdown provided.
- onRails gives you a plain-language setup change recommendation for that subject.
- Return to the sim to apply and try that recommendation.
- Repeat as many times as needed until you’re happy with that subject, then move to the next one.
A breadcrumb strip across the top tracks your progress through all 12 groups, so you always know how far you are from done.
Every question panel has an i (info) button at the top-right of each panel. Click it if the question itself isn’t enough context — it opens a plain-language explanation of what that subject actually affects on the car and why it matters, without leaving the question.
Once you’ve got a recommendation and want to go try it on track, click Hide UI on the question panel. This tucks the whole panel out of the way so you can drive a clean lap without it in your line of sight — SD doesn’t lose your place, it just gets out of the way.
When you’re ready to come back, a button reading I’M READY TO BUILD MY SETUP appears in the header. Click it and onRails restores you to the exact question you were on, breadcrumbs and all.
The lap logger
While you’re testing a subject’s recommendation, log your lap times as you go. If your sim is connected, Num * captures your last lap time automatically; otherwise you can type a time in directly. The logger keeps a running list — with the delta from the previous lap — so you can see whether a change actually helped before moving on.
The lap logger is entirely optional, and can be turned off in Settings if you’d rather not deal with it. That said, it’s highly recommended: onRails uses it to track your lap times as your setup progresses subject by subject, and gives you a full summary at the end showing every subject you worked through and how your times moved as a result. Skipping it means skipping that record — the setup advice itself works exactly the same either way.
Tires & Camber
Two questions in the flow ask for tire temperatures — inner, middle, and outer for all four corners. If your sim is connected, press Num / (the tire temp snapshot hotkey) to pull live temps straight from the sim instead of typing them in.
onRails reads the inner/middle/outer spread on each tire and tells you three things: whether you’re running toward understeer or oversteer, whether your camber is right, and whether your tire pressures are matched to the load each tire is seeing. This is the same math the Setup Engineer uses, just tuned a little more forgiving — the Setup Developer Module is meant to catch big baseline problems, not chase small session-to-session noise.
Entering tire temps isn’t required — you can skip past these questions if you want — but it’s heavily recommended. Tires are too important to leave unchecked, and this is where onRails really shines: a couple of temp readings tell you more about what your car is actually doing than almost any other single input you can give it.
